SUBJECT
Title
Actions pertaining to an operations agreement with the State of California Department of Parks and Recreation:
1. ***RESOLUTION - Adopting the 3rd Amendment to the Annual Appropriation Resolution (AAR) No. 2022-154 to appropriate $140,000 for the operations and maintenance, and capital outlays relating to the Maxie L. Parks Community Center, located at 1802 E. California Ave., Fresno, CA 93706 (Requires 5 Affirmative Votes) (Subject to Mayor's Veto)
2. Approve an operations agreement between the Parks, After School, Recreation and Community Services Department (PARCS) and the State of California Department of Parks and Recreation (State Parks) for the acceptance of settlement funds in the amount of $70,000 annually, not to exceed $700,000 over ten years, from an escrow account established by State Parks for distribution to the City of Fresno (City) for Maxie. L Parks Community Center (Council District 3).
3. Authorize the PARCS Director or their designee to execute the operations agreement.


Body
RECOMMENDATION

Staff recommends that City Council adopt the 3rd Amendment to the AAR No. 2022-154 allocating $140,000 for operations, maintenance and capital outlays for Maxie L. Parks Community Center, approve an operations agreement with State Parks, and authorize the PARCS Director to execute the operations agreement on behalf of the City.

EXECUTIVE SUMMARY

State Parks has established an escrow account to distribute settlement funds to the City for the operations, maintenance, and capital outlays at Maxie L. Parks Community Center. The escrow account was established in 2020 and has accrued $140,000 thus far. The escrow account will continue to accrue $70,000 annually through June 2030, for a not to exceed...
